The Michelangelo school is situated in Bari and the pupils belong to the middle class. The Institute is structured on three floors with classrooms, laboratories of technics, music, art and computer, and an Auditorium for the dramatizations and meetings.

In the school disables of different desease are welcome. There are specialized laboratories and activities, managed by the technological operator and mostly by the local Sanitary Service.There are eight courses, called sections. Each section is formed by three classes: first, second and third class.

The pupils are 655 (from 11 to 14 years old). Four courses have five lessons a day from 8 a.m. to 1 p.m., 30 lessons a week, while the pupils attending the other four courses have lunch at school and the lessons finish at 4 p.m.. These last courses, called ‘tempo prolungato’, have 36 lessons a week with activities of laboratories and ‘open classes’.

The general plan of the activities is prepared by the teaching team of the school, directed by the Principal Mrs Francesca Roca.

Extra curricular activities are cineforum, sport games, projects ofeducation to peace, dramas, intercultural projects and multimedial activities.

Every year in november, all the classes take part in a scientific project, wich aims to promote the interests of the young people in the scientific and technological culture.

The main finality of the Michelangelo school is to prepare the pupils to gain a better quality of life through a solid cultural knowledge.

The curricular foreign language is English but the pupils can attend extra curricular courses of French, German and Spanish. The pupils of many classes exchange letters, drawings and other works with twin schools in other European Countries. Many teachers of the school are concerned with the didactic experimentation of History, new methods of both Technological programs and Mathematics.

The disable children are integrated with their luckier friends and take part in the common activities organized by the school team of teachers but specialised teachers lead them in individualized programms responding to the needs of each of them.

The social and cultural levels of the pupils attending the school is medium-high and they all are going to attend the secondary high schools after the third year. To meet their need the teacher’s team plans many activities in order to increase interests, promote aptitudes and help them in the choices for their future.

Extra curricular activities are: cineforum, dramas, youth games, health education and different projects such as the scientific and technologic culture’s week, a project for the cooperation between North and South Countries, an experimentation of a new method for learning history and multimedial laboratories.
